"Sir Rowland Hill: The Story of a Great Reform" by Eleanor C. Hill Smyth is a biography that chronicles the life and groundbreaking achievements of Sir Rowland Hill, the visionary behind postal reform in Britain. The book examines Hill’s revolutionary idea of affordable postage and its profound impact on reshaping communication across the nation, shedding light on the stark contrast with the burdensome old postal system that restricted connections and imposed heavy financial strains on families and businesses. The narrative begins with detailed depictions of the unjust and expensive postal service of the time, offering a view into the daily challenges individuals faced when trying to stay in touch with loved ones due to exorbitant costs. By examining Hill’s early life and the influences that shaped him, the story illustrates the urgent need for change in a society hindered by outdated systems, underscoring the personal drive and determination that propelled Hill to confront a deeply unfair and established order.
